| Use Case Classification | No. of Transactions | Weight |
|---|---|---|
| Simple | 1 to 3 transactions | 5 |
| Average | 4 to 7 transactions | 10 |
| Complex | 8 or more transactions | 15 |
| Actor Classification | Type of Actor | Weight |
|---|---|---|
| Simple | External system that must interact with the system using a well-defined API | 1 |
| Average | External system that must interact with the system using standard communication protocols | 2 |
| Complex | Human actor using a GUI application interface | 3 |
